Fruits and their products — Potassium supply — Value in United States of America
United States of America: Fruits and their products — Potassium supply — Value was 301 mg/cap/d in 2023. ▬ Flat
Fruits and their products — Potassium supply — Value in United States of America, 2010–2023
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in mg/cap/d.
Analysis
United States of America recorded 301 mg/cap/d for fruits and their products — potassium supply — value in 2023.
The figure is up 0.7% on the previous year and down 8.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, fruits and their products — potassium supply — value in United States of America peaked at 328 mg/cap/d in 2013 and was at its lowest, 297 mg/cap/d, in 2014.

About this data
The dataset presents average daily per capita macro and micro nutrient availability by country and by FAO/WHO GIFT food groups (that are different from those used for the Food Balance Sheets), expressed in grams/milligrams/micrograms/kcal per capita per day. The population numbers used to calculate these statistics can be found in the Supply Utilization Accounts (SUA) dataset of FAOSTAT, as Total Population. Food availability quantities are derived from the SUA dataset. SUAs present a comprehensive picture of the pattern of a country's food supply and utilization during a specified reference period. The SUA shows for each food item - i.e. each primary commodity and a number of processed commodities potentially available for human consumption - the sources of supply and its utilization. The total quantity of foodstuffs produced in a country added to the total quantity imported and adjusted to any change in stocks that may have occurred since the beginning of the reference period gives the supply available during that period. On the utilization side a distinction is made between the quantities exported, fed to livestock, used for seed, put to manufacture for food use and non-food uses, losses during storage and transportation, and food supplies available for human consumption. The per capita supply of each such food item available for human consumption is then obtained by dividing the respective quantity by the related data on the population actually partaking of it.
